| 正面描述 | The obverse features the coat of arms of the Republic of Palau centered within the field, depicting a traditional scene with a merman figure flanked by sea creatures on a shield, with the inscription 'RAINBOW'S END' on a scroll at the base of the shield. Above the arms, a traditional Palauan outrigger canoe with a figure is depicted. The encircling legend 'REPUBLIC OF PALAU' arcs across the upper field, with a row of small stars flanking the coat of arms on either side. The denomination '2$' is inscribed at the bottom of the field in bold numerals. |

The Gorch Fock II is the German Navy's sail training ship, commissioned in 1958 and still active — one of the longest-serving vessels of its type in any modern fleet. Palau has issued numerous nautical-themed silver pieces under licensing arrangements that have made it one of the more prolific small-nation issuers of collector coinage since the 1990s.
The Kahle reference indicates this falls within a documented series, suggesting multiple Gorch Fock issues exist under the same cataloging framework.
